HR Change Manager
Job Details
An exciting opportunity has arisen to join a world leading global organisation, our client Leading Global FMCG company with Brands such as Dove, Knorr, Persil & Magnum are currently looking for a HR Change Manager based at their prestigious facility in Leatherhead. This is a full-time temporary role for a period of 6 months with the likelihood to be extended to 12months+, working a 36.25-hour week. This role is paying between £53,600 and £67,000 per annum, pro rata, depending on experience.
Role Description
This role will work across the team of HR partners as well as the HRVP and will be part of a project team working on the digital transformation of the UKI business, across all functions.
Key Responsibilities
- Working with the project team and project manager of the transformation as the day to day HR lead for multiple projects
- ensuring delivery of organisational savings in line with plan, including partnership with finance
- monitoring and tracking progress of people elements of the project including recruitment, communication, training and consultation as well as other various elements
- working with HR Director to define key success criteria for the project
- working with communications to build a comprehensive, ongoing communications and change plan for the business
- working on a skills assessment defining the "future skills needs" for a business which is digitally transforming
Key Requirements
- Understanding of consultation requirements and timelines.
- Experience of working and influencing senior stakeholders across multiple functions of the business
- Experience of working on a large-scale HR transformation project
- Strong track record of business facing HR roles
- Strong experience of organisational design and organisational effectiveness is essential
- Work well as part of a project team as a well as delivering independently on critical HR workstreams
- Excellent communication and presentation skills is essential
- Ability to demonstrate awareness of the broader impact of change across a global organisation, would also be desirable
